Stronger Absolutely makes a case for the resinous, boozy side of masculine grooming. The opening pairs bergamot with elemi and a clear rum facet, so the first impression is bright yet soaked in spirit. Lavender appears soon after, but it is not the barbershop kind. Davana pushes the heart toward a dried, slightly fruity herbal tone that keeps the lavender from leaning clean or soapy.
Cedar and patchouli anchor the drydown, but the chestnut and vanilla reshape the wood into something rounded and edible without becoming a dessert. The balsamic and warm spicy facets give the base a resinous weight that feels deliberate rather than accidental. This is a fragrance for someone who wants aromatic clarity and woody depth without surrendering the comfort of a gourmand finish.
The rum and davana combination is the strongest argument here, because they pull the lavender away from tradition and into a darker, more personal space. Chestnut and vanilla do the same for the cedar, making the foundation feel lived in and slightly sweet rather than stark. The composition holds together as a single, resin-heavy statement that favors warmth over freshness, and it asks the wearer to accept that the spices and woods will stay close to the skin
